Who Is Gary Vaynerchuk?

Gary Vaynerchuk is a serial entrepreneur, investor, and social networks personality known for his work in digital marketing and business advancement. Born in Babruysk, Belarus, in 1975, he immigrated to the United States with his household at age three.

Vaynerchuk initially gained acknowledgment by transforming his family’s wine organization from a local liquor store into a major e-commerce operation. He developed Wine Library into a $60 million company through ingenious use of internet marketing and video material. His video blog “Wine Library TV” ran from 2006 to 2011 and helped develop him as an early authority on digital marketing.

The Wine Library Success Story

Gary Vaynerchuk joined his family’s retail red wine company in 1996 after finishing from college. The shop, originally called Shopper’s Discount Liquors, was relabelled Wine Library and operated out of Springfield, New Jersey.

He transformed the traditional brick-and-mortar shop into an e-commerce powerhouse. Gary acknowledged the potential of the web early and launched winelibrary.com to reach customers beyond the area. Under his direction, business grew from $3 million to over $60 million in annual income within a five-year period.

In 2006, he released Wine Library television, a day-to-day video blog site on YouTube that reviewed wines in an unconventional, energetic design. The show ran for nearly 1,000 episodes and attracted a considerable following. This move showed his understanding of emerging digital platforms and material marketing.

Key elements of his Wine Library strategy consisted of:

Direct engagement with customers through video material
Building an online wine community
Making wine education available and amusing
Leveraging e-commerce to broaden market reach

His approach to entrepreneurship at Wine Library integrated conventional retail understanding with digital innovation. He invested hours reacting to client e-mails and comments, developing relationships that translated into sales and brand commitment.

The Wine Library experience established Gary as a voice in both the white wine industry and digital marketing. His success with the household business offered the foundation and trustworthiness for his later endeavors in marketing and entrepreneurship.

VaynerX and the VaynerMedia Empire

Gary Vaynerchuk founded VaynerMedia in 2009 as a digital advertising agency with his bro AJ Vaynerchuk. The company rapidly grew to serve significant Fortune 1000 brand names seeking expertise in social networks marketing and digital technique.

VaynerMedia established itself by assisting business like PepsiCo browse the evolving digital landscape. The firm’s method concentrated on creating content specifically developed for social media platforms instead of repurposing conventional marketing.

In 2017, Vaynerchuk produced VaynerX as a moms and dad company to house VaynerMedia and other ventures. This holding company structure enabled growth into different areas while maintaining the core marketing business.

Material Platforms and Media Presence.

Gary Vaynerchuk keeps a substantial presence across multiple digital platforms. His content method focuses on dispersing guidance about entrepreneurship, marketing, and individual development through numerous formats.

DailyVee acts as his long-running video documentary series on YouTube. The show offers behind-the-scenes access to his day-to-day activities, conferences, and service operations. Episodes usually run in between 10 to 20 minutes and offer unfiltered insights into his work procedure.

His podcast, The GaryVee Audio Experience, repurposes content from his other platforms into audio format. The program features keynote speeches, interviews, and sections from his video material. It allows audiences to consume his product during commutes or other activities where video watching isn’t useful.

The #AskGaryVee show ran as a question-and-answer series where Vaynerchuk reacted to viewer submissions about business and marketing. The format combined direct suggestions with his characteristic straightforward interaction style.

He disperses content everyday throughout platforms consisting of Instagram, Twitter, LinkedIn, TikTok, and Facebook. His team repurposes longer content into platform-specific formats to maximize reach. This multi-platform method reflects his belief in conference audiences where they already spend their time online.

Books and Thought Leadership.

Gary Vaynerchuk has developed himself as a New York Times bestselling author through several publications that focus on entrepreneurship, marketing, and personal development. His first book, Crush It!, released in 2009, encouraged readers to monetize their passions through social networks and individual branding.

In 2013, he launched Jab, Jab, Jab, Right Hook, which described his method for social media marketing. The book emphasized the importance of providing value to audiences before making sales pitches. The Thank You Economy, another noteworthy work, examined how companies should adjust to customer expectations in the digital age.

His publisher HarperCollins has actually dealt with him on numerous titles. Twelve and a Half explored emotional intelligence and the function of soft abilities in company success. The book recognized twelve important emotional ingredients plus one that Vaynerchuk thinks about critical for professional achievement.

Day Trading Attention represents his latest contribution to marketing literature. The book focuses on understanding and taking advantage of consumer attention throughout various platforms and media channels.

His books usually blend useful recommendations with his direct interaction design. They often include case studies, platform-specific methods, and actionable structures. As a successful author, Vaynerchuk has actually offered millions of copies worldwide.

VeeFriends, Collectibles, and New Ventures.

In May 2021, Gary Vaynerchuk launched VeeFriends, an NFT collection featuring 10,255 special character tokens. Each token approved holders access to VeeCon, a yearly service and marketing conference.

The task represented his entry into the blockchain and digital collectibles area. VeeFriends characters embodied various qualities and worths that Vaynerchuk considered essential for service and life.

VeeCon debuted in Minneapolis in 2022 as a multi-day occasion specifically for VeeFriends token holders. The conference featured speakers, networking chances, and entertainment. Subsequent VeeCon events continued to serve as a main energy for NFT holders.

The VeeFriends community expanded with additional collections:.

VeeFriends Series 2 – Released in 2022 with new characters and energies.
VeeFriends Book Games – A buddy series tied to his kids’s book initiatives.
Mini-collections and special editions.

Vaynerchuk partnered with Macy’s in 2022 to bring VeeFriends characters to physical merchandise, consisting of toys and clothing. This relocation bridged his digital antiques with conventional retail circulation.

He positioned VeeFriends as an intellectual property brand with strategies extending beyond NFTs. The characters appeared in various formats including books, toys, and prospective media content.

The project dealt with obstacles during the more comprehensive NFT market decrease in 2022-2023. Vaynerchuk kept his dedication to providing value to token holders through VeeCon and other energies regardless of market conditions.
